The Manufacturing Method of Pressed Aluminium Boxes
Typically, the production of extruded aluminum enclosures begins with billet alu material. This material is then pushed through a form using an extrusion machine, producing a long profile. Once extrusion, the profile undergoes slicing to accurate lengths. Subsequent, stages might involve perforating for fixing points and machining for features. Finally, the enclosure is processed – typically through plating – to enhance rust immunity and look. Control checks are carried out at the entire production period.
